"This book was designed by Peter Oldenburg and fifteen thousand copies have been printed of the first edition. In order to reproduce as nearly as possible the look of the original prints, two different printing processes were used. Letterpress, by The Spiral Press, was used for the woodcuts, wood engravings, and line drawings, and offset lithography, by the Meriden Gravure Company, for the etchings and engravings. The plates for the illustrations were made directly from the originals, except for a few books too fragile to be removed from the Museum. The text was set in Linotype Janson, with hand-set Bulmer for display, and printed by The Spiral Press. The paper is Mohawk Superfine. The book was bound in Columbia Lynbrook cloth by J.F. Tapley Company, and the jacket was printeed by the Meriden Gravure Company.".
